The Drug Detox Journey: A Detailed Breakdown

The process of drug cleansing is often seen as a difficult undertaking, and a complete understanding of what to anticipate is vital for recovery. It's far more than just quitting substance ingestion; it's a involved corporeal and emotional transformation.

The initial stage usually website involves acute abstinence indications that can vary from mild discomfort to intense distress. These signs can include queasiness, vomiting, tremors, anxiety, and sleeplessness. Medical monitoring during this time is very recommended to handle these distressing experiences and prevent likely issues.

Following the acute withdrawal phase, a stabilization stage commences, which may extend for several periods. During this interval, individuals may encounter ongoing cravings and internal difficulties. Support networks, such as treatment, group sessions, and kin, are crucial for managing this fragile period.

Ultimately, a fruitful drug withdrawal path requires dedication, professional guidance, and a strong framework. It’s a substantial step towards long-term recovery.
